When choosing a single-ended heating element that suits your needs, you should first consider the following factors:
Heating element voltage and wattage: Determine the required heating wattage based on the volume and material of the object being heated. Generally, higher heating element wattage results in better heating results, but you should also consider whether the supply voltage meets the requirements.
Heating element size and shape: Select an appropriate heating element based on the shape and size of the object being heated. Heating elements can often be customized to meet customer requirements, so it's important to measure the dimensions of the object being heated in advance.
Heating element material: Select the appropriate heating element material based on the characteristics of the object being heated and the environmental conditions. Common heating element materials include stainless steel and nickel-chromium alloy. Different materials have different heating efficiencies and high-temperature resistance, so the choice should be tailored to your specific needs.
Heating element durability and maintenance: The lifespan of a heating element is affected by many factors, such as operating temperature, operating environment, and element quality. Choosing a heating element that is heat-resistant, corrosion-resistant, and easy to maintain can reduce future repair and replacement costs.
Heating element temperature control: Select the appropriate heating element temperature control method based on your needs. Common temperature control methods include constant temperature, timer, and temperature control loop. Choose the appropriate temperature control method based on your specific requirements to achieve the most accurate heating effect.
Heater Hose Safety: Consider the safety features of the heater, including leakage protection, overheating protection, and explosion-proof features. Choose heaters with multiple safety features to ensure a safe heating process.
Price and Cost-Effectiveness of the Heater Hose: Select the appropriate heater hose based on your budget and performance requirements. Prices vary between brands and models, so it's important to compare and select the most cost-effective option.
